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2019-02-21 REF. TO JOINT COMM. ON Human Services referral-committee
  • 2019-02-22 PUBLIC HEARING 0228
  • 2019-03-19 Joint Favorable Substitute committee-passage-favorable
  • 2019-03-19 FILED WITH LCO
  • 2019-03-29 REFERRED TO Office of Legislative Research AND Office of Fiscal Analysis 04/03/19
  • 2019-04-04 RPTD. OUT OF LCO
  • 2019-04-04 FAV. RPT., TABLED FOR HOUSE CALENDER
  • 2019-04-04 HOUSE CALENDAR NUMBER 276
  • 2019-04-04 FILE NO. 424
  • 2019-04-10 REF. BY HOUSE TO COMMITTEE ON Education referral-committee
  • 2019-04-15 Joint Favorable committee-passage-favorable
  • 2019-04-16 FILED WITH LCO
  • 2019-04-16 RPTD. OUT OF LCO
  • 2019-04-16 NO NEW FILE BY COMM. ON Education referral-committee
  • 2019-04-16 TABLED FOR HOUSE CALENDAR
  • 2019-04-24 HOUSE PASSED passage
  • 2019-04-25 FAV. RPT., TAB. FOR CAL., SEN.
  • 2019-04-25 SENATE CALENDAR NUMBER 412
  • 2019-06-04 SENATE PASSED passage
  • 2019-06-04 ON CONSENT CALENDAR /IN CONCURRENCE
  • 2019-06-13 PUBLIC ACT 19-49 became-law
  • 2019-06-19 TRANSMITTED TO SECRETARY OF THE STATE
  • 2019-06-19 TRANSMITTED BY SECRETARY OF THE STATE TO GOVERNOR
  • 2019-06-21 SIGNED BY GOVERNOR executive-signature
